The men start off recapping Al's wasp attack in the previous episode's 'Overtime' segment for Zach. Phil says he's never seen Al move that fast. Jase came to his big brother's defense to kill the wasp after he'd stung Al. Zach is in awe of Phil being able to pivot and keep preaching about the sting of sin in the midst of it all. Phil recounts Si's worst bumblee attack when he was a boy. Plus, continuing in the study of Mark, why the Gospel is a message of urgency. We're the salt of the earth - be salty!
